Lahore Qalandars crushed Islamabad United by 110 runs in the 16th game of the ongoing eighth season of the Pakistan Premier League (PSL) at the Gaddafi Stadium in Lahore on Monday.

After deciding to bat first, Lahore set a lofty aim of 201 runs before dismissing Islamabad for 90 runs in 13.5 overs, all owing to outstanding innings by Abdullah Shafique and some outstanding bowling from David Wiese and Sikandar Raza.

Apart from the opening stand of 41 runs between Rahmanullah Gurbaz and Colin Munro in response to the large total, Islamabad was unable to establish a partnership and struggled to get going.

As openers Colin Munro and Gurbaz (23) helped Islamabad get off to a solid start, Zaman Khan gave Lahore a much-needed victory.

Gurbaz mistimed a slow, short bowl from Zaman, and Fakhar Zaman responded with a blinder to send the Afghan hitter back to the pavilion.

Gurbaz left shortly after Shaheen introduced David Wiese, who defeated Colin Munro and brought Islamabad’s score to 54-2.

The left-handed batter needed only 14 balls to score 18 runs.

In the following over, Rassie van der Dussen (3) was sent packing by fiery pacer Haris Rauf.

After a successful review, Wiese once again delivered, sending Islamabad’s captain Shadab Khan (4) back to the pavilion.

Islamabad continued to lose wickets. Asif Ali attempted to increase the run rate by going for a six but was ultimately caught by Haris off Rashid Khan.

Wiese trapped Azam Khan for a lbw, adding to Islamabad’s woes. The wicket-keeper hitter, who had previously amassed 96 runs against the Quetta Gladiators, was dismissed after scoring just four runs.

By bowling Tom Curran, the wizard Rashid scored his second of the evening (10).

In the fourteenth over, Hasan Ali, Abrar Ahmed, and Zeeshan Zameer were returned.

Wiese collected three wickets for Lahore, while Rashid and Raza each claimed two victims. Each wicket was secured by Zaman and Haris.

Lahore Qalandars had earlier set Islamabad United a 201-run goal.

Lahore Qalandars got off to a strong start against Islamabad United thanks to Tahir Baig and Fakhar Zaman. For the first wicket, the two batters cobbled together a 58-run goal.

To counter this, Shadab Khan knocked out Tahir after he had scored 20 runs off of 17 balls, providing Islamabad with a much-needed breakthrough.

Fakhar was out in the following over by Tom Curran. The ball fell the stumps after an inside edge as the left-handed hitter attempted to go for a bid stroke.

Nonetheless, the assault persisted as Sam Billings and Abdullah Shafique kept scoring goals.

Sam and Abdullah combined for a brilliant 71 runs off just 38 balls. The important partnership was broken, though, when Curran struck again and dismissed Abdullah, who was caught by Rahmanullah Gurbaz at midwicket.

After making 45 runs off 24 balls, including four boundaries and two maximums, the 23-year-old was dismissed.

The next batter to leave the game was Billings after his countryman defeated him. 33 runs were scored by the right-handed batsman on 23 balls.

David Weise (12) entered the crease after Billings left, but Abrar Ahmed yanked him away.

Rashid Khan, a spinner, also made a significant cameo with 18 runs, including two boundaries and a six. nonetheless, Hasan Ali won.

Sikandar Raza, an all-rounder, scored 23 runs off 10 balls in the meanwhile.

The earlier toss had been won by Lahore, who chose to bat first against Islamabad.

Both teams will be fired up after their recent emphatic victories. In Karachi, United overcame Quetta Gladiators, while yesterday night in Lahore, Qalandars triumphed over Peshawar Zalmi.
